Visual Basic程序设计教程

Visual Basic程序设计教程

胡声艳, 李为华, 主编

出版社:人民邮电出版社

年代:2007

定价:25.0

书籍简介:

本书介绍了VB的程序设计语言的基本概念和语法结构以及常用控件的使用。

书籍目录:

第1章VB程序设计概述1

1.1概述1

1.1.1VB的简介1

1.1.2VB的特点1

1.2VB的启动和退出2

1.2.1启动2

1.2.2退出2

1.3VB的集成开发环境3

1.3.1主窗口4

1.3.2属性窗口5

1.3.3工程资源管理器窗口6

1.3.4代码窗口6

1.3.5工具箱窗口7

1.3.6窗体设计器窗口8

1.3.7其他窗口8

本章小结9

习题9第2章对象及建立简单的VB应用程序12

2.1对象的概念12

2.1.1对象的建立和编辑12

2.1.2对象的属性、事件和方法14

2.2建立简单的VB应用程序16

2.2.1建立应用程序用户界面16

2.2.2对象属性的设置16

2.2.3对象事件过程及编辑17

2.2.4保存和运行程序18

2.3窗体和常用基本控件21

2.3.1窗体21

2.3.2标签25

2.3.3文本框26

2.3.4命令按钮28

2.3.5应用举例29

2.4工程的管理及程序的调试33

2.4.1工程的组成33

2.4.2创建、打开和保存工程34

2.4.3生成可执行文件34

2.4.4添加、删除和保存文件35

2.4.5程序的调试35

本章小结40

习题40第3章VB程序设计基础43

3.1数据类型43

3.1.1标准数据类型43

3.1.2自定义数据类型45

3.2常量和变量46

3.2.1常量46

3.2.2变量47

3.3变量的作用域503.3.1局部变量51

3.3.2窗体模块级变量51

3.3.3全局变量52

3.4运算符和表达式52

3.4.1算术运算符52

3.4.2关系与逻辑运算符54

3.4.3表达式及表达式的执行顺序56

3.4.4常用内部函数56

本章小结59

习题60第4章数据的输入输出62

4.1数据输出  Print方法62

4.1.1Print方法62

4.1.2与Print有关的函数63

4.1.3格式输出64

4.1.4其他方法和属性64

4.2数据输入  InputBox函数66

4.3MsgBox函数和MsgBox语句67

4.3.1MsgBox函数67

4.3.2MsgBox语句70

4.4打印机输出71

4.4.1直接输出71

4.4.2窗体输出72

本章小结73

习题73第5章基本的控制结构76

5.1顺序程序设计76

5.1.1顺序程序的结构76

5.1.2顺序程序结构的设计方法76

5.2选择程序设计77

5.2.1选择结构77

5.2.2If语句78

5.2.3IIF函数83

5.2.4SelectCase语句84

5.3循环结构87

5.3.1For循环控制结构87

5.3.2Do…Loop循环89

5.3.3循环嵌套91

本章小结94

习题95第6章数组100

6.1数组的基本概念100

6.2静态数组与动态数组100

6.2.1静态数组及其定义100

6.2.2动态数组及其声明102

6.3数组的基本操作与Array函数104

6.3.1数组的赋值(整体赋值)1046.3.2数组元素的输入和输出105

6.3.3数组元素的交换106

6.3.4数组的清除和重新定义106

6.3.5数组函数Array()107

6.4控件数组108

6.4.1控件数组的概念108

6.4.2控件数组的建立108

6.5常用算法110

6.5.1在数组中求极值110

6.5.2数据排序111

6.5.3数组中元素的插入与删除113

本章小结115

习题116第7章过程121

7.1子程序过程(Sub过程)121

7.1.1子程序过程(Sub过程序)的建立121

7.1.2子程序过程(Sub过程)的调用122

7.1.3子程序过程(Sub过程)与系统事件过程124

7.2函数过程(Function过程)125

7.2.1函数过程(Function过程)的建立125

7.2.2函数过程(Function过程)的调用126

7.3参数传递127

7.3.1传址(引用)与传值127

7.3.2数组参数的传递128

7.4过程的作用域129

7.5VB的工程结构130

7.5.1SubMain过程130

7.5.2模块过程131

本章小结132

习题133第8章常用控件139

8.1选择性控件139

8.1.1单选按钮和复选框139

8.1.2框架143

8.1.3列表框和组合框144

8.1.4滚动条150

8.2时钟152

8.3高级控件154

8.3.1Slider控件155

8.3.2SSTab控件156

8.3.3UpDown控件157

8.4鼠标与键盘159

8.4.1鼠标器159

8.4.2键盘163

本章小结166

习题166第9章界面设计1679.1通用对话框167

9.1.1“文件”对话框168

9.1.2“颜色”对话框172

9.1.3“字体”对话框173

9.1.4“打印”对话框174

9.1.5“帮助”对话框175

9.2菜单设计176

9.2.1菜单编辑器的使用176

9.2.2菜单项的控制177

9.2.3菜单项的增减178

9.2.4弹出式菜单179

9.3多重窗体和多文档界面179

9.3.1多重窗体的操作179

9.3.2多文档界面181

9.4工具栏和状态栏183

9.4.1在ImageList控件中添加图像184

9.4.2在ToolBar控件中添加按钮184

9.4.3响应ToolBar控件事件185

9.4.4状态栏185

9.5RichTextBox控件186

本章小结187

习题188第10章文件190

10.1文件系统控件190

10.1.1驱动器列表和目录列表框190

10.1.2文件列表框191

10.2文件概述193

10.2.1文件结构与文件指针193

10.2.2文件的打开(建立)和关闭193

10.2.3与文件操作有关的语句和函数194

10.3顺序文件195

10.3.1顺序文件的写操作195

10.3.2顺序文件的读操作196

10.4随机文件198

10.4.1随机文件的读操作198

10.4.2随机文件的写操作198

10.4.3随机文件中记录的增加与删除200

10.5文件基本操作200

本章小结203

习题205第11章图形操作207

11.1图形操作的基础207

11.1.1坐标系统207

11.1.2自定义坐标系208

11.1.3图形层210

11.2绘图属性211

11.2.1当前坐标211

11.2.2线宽与线型21211.2.3填充与色彩213

11.3图形控件214

11.3.1PictureBox(图形框)214

11.3.2Image(图像框)214

11.3.3Line(画线工具)216

11.3.4Shape(形状)216

11.4图形方法217

11.4.1Line方法217

11.4.2Circle方法218

11.4.3Pset方法219

11.5作图实例220

本章小结221

习题222第12章VB与数据库224

12.1有关数据库的基本知识224

12.1.1数据库基本知识简介224

12.1.2数据库引擎225

12.1.3设计数据库的步骤225

12.2数据库管理器226

12.3数据控件229

12.3.1Data控件229

12.3.2Data控件的主要属性230

12.3.3Data控件的主要事件232

12.3.4Data控件的主要方法233

12.4记录集对象233

12.4.1记录集对象的属性233

12.4.2记录集对象的方法234

12.4.3记录的操作235

12.5数据感知控件237

12.6综合实例238

12.7使用对象变量访问数据库242

12.8使用SQL245

12.9ADO简介246

12.10使用ADO数据控件247

12.11数据报表设计248

12.11.1数据环境设计器248

12.11.2报表设计器249

12.11.3设计报表250

12.12VB.NET简介252

12.12.1VB.NET的新特点253

12.12.2VB.NET的新技术253

本章小结254

习题254附录VB工程实例  学生信息管理系统256

内容摘要:

  本书主要介绍VisualBasic程序设计语言的基本概念和语法结构以及常用控件的使用,并通过大量的例子介绍VB程序设计的方法和技巧,内容包括:VB程序设计基础、对象及VB应用程序的建立、数据的输入与输出、基本的控制结构、数组和过程的程序设计、常用控件的使用、界面设计、图形操作、文件、数据库技术等。本书内容全面,讲解深入浅出,具有很强的实用性和可操作性。
  本书主要介绍VisualBasic(简称VB)程序设计语言的基本概念和语法结构以及常用控件的使用,并通过大量的例子介绍VB程序设计的方法和技巧,内容包括:VB程序设计基础、对象及VB应用程序的建立、数据的输入与输出、基本的控制结构、数组和过程的程序设计、常用控件的使用、界面设计、图形操作、文件、数据库技术等。在这些内容的讲解中,坚持语言为程序设计服务的原则,注重实用性。  本书在编排上,采用由浅到深、循序渐进的结构,做到通俗易懂,既有针对初学者的基本知识的介绍,也有针对已经掌握VB程序基本设计方法的学生对高层次内容的要求,将程序设计语言、可视化的面向对象编程技术、上机训练有机地融为一体。突出VB的基本语法、编程方法的训练,让学生学会分析问题并快速掌握面向对象的程序、界面设计、数据库技术的设计技巧,培养学生的动手能力和开发应用程序的能力。  本书为各类高等职业院校计算机专业和非计算机专业的教材,也可提供给计算机爱好者自学,同时可作为从事软件开发、程序设计及计算机教学人员的参考书。

书籍规格:

书籍详细信息
书名Visual Basic程序设计教程站内查询相似图书
丛书名高职高专现代信息技术系列教材
9787115157669
如需购买下载《Visual Basic程序设计教程》pdf扫描版电子书或查询更多相关信息,请直接复制isbn,搜索即可全网搜索该ISBN
出版地北京出版单位人民邮电出版社
版次1版印次1
定价(元)25.0语种简体中文
尺寸26装帧平装
页数 152 印数

书籍信息归属:

Visual Basic程序设计教程是人民邮电出版社于2007.02出版的中图分类号为 TP312 的主题关于 BASIC语言-程序设计-高等学校-教材 的书籍。